Some summers are meant to be forgotten.
Others change everything.
At sixteen, Rowan returns to Pinebrook after a year away, carrying more questions than answers. The town looks the same-quiet streets, familiar faces, old gathering spots-but the feeling of belonging no longer comes easily. Friendships feel strained by unspoken hurt, and the past lingers in ways Rowan isn't prepared to confront.
What Rowan doesn't expect is Eli.
Once just a familiar presence in the background of childhood, Eli has changed too-more thoughtful, more guarded, and suddenly impossible to ignore. As summer unfolds through small-town fairs, late-night conversations, and quiet moments beneath open skies, a tentative connection grows into something deeper.
But trust doesn't come easily.
Rumors spread quickly in a town where everyone watches and remembers. Misunderstandings resurface old fears. Both Rowan and Eli must face the truth about why leaving felt safer than staying-and why love, when it's real, asks for courage instead of escape.
Summer of Second Chances is a gentle, emotionally grounded coming-of-age novel about first love, forgiveness, and learning how to be seen without running away. It explores the fragile space between who we were and who we're becoming, and the quiet bravery it takes to choose connection over fear.
